NBA title runs are often reduced to a single result: one team became champion and every other team fell short. That outcome matters most, but it does not reveal how difficult the champion’s path was, how convincingly it played or which moments changed the postseason.
A data-first comparison should examine more than championship count. Useful measures include opponent quality, series length, winning margin, injuries, road performance and the number of elimination games faced. Even then, conclusions should remain cautious because playoff structures and league conditions have changed across eras.
The fairest approach is to treat every title run as a route with its own obstacles rather than assuming all routes were equally demanding.
1. Start With the Playoff Format
Before comparing champions, analysts should establish how many rounds and victories each team needed.
The modern postseason contains four best-of-seven rounds. Eight teams from each conference enter the main bracket, with the seventh and eighth seeds determined through the Play-In Tournament involving teams placed seventh through tenth. The first round did not become best-of-seven until 2003, and NBA teams from earlier periods sometimes faced shorter postseason paths.
That difference affects raw win totals. A modern champion generally needs 16 playoff victories, while champions from earlier structures could win the title with fewer.
A useful playoff structure guide should therefore separate two ideas:
• How many series did the team win?
• How efficiently did it complete the format available at the time?
A team should not be penalised for competing under the rules of its era. However, its total playoff victories should not be directly compared with a modern champion without adjustment.
2. Measure the Strength of the Opponents
Championship teams are sometimes ranked according to their own regular-season record, but the quality of their opponents may be equally important.
One basic method is to add the regular-season winning percentages of every team the champion defeated. A more detailed approach can include point differential, seeding and performance after the All-Star break.
However, seeding alone can mislead. A low-seeded opponent may have recovered from injuries late in the season or improved after a major trade. A first seed may also reach the playoffs with health problems that make it weaker than its full-season record suggests.
Analysts should therefore describe schedule strength as an estimate rather than proof. A title path featuring several 50-win teams probably appears difficult, but win totals do not capture every tactical matchup or injury circumstance.
The question is not simply, “How many strong teams did the champion face?” It is also, “How strong were those teams when the series actually began?”
3. Use Series Length Carefully
A short series can indicate dominance. Sweeping an opponent prevents it from extending the matchup, making adjustments or forcing additional travel.
The 2017 Golden State Warriors finished the postseason 16–1, producing the highest single-postseason winning percentage since the first round adopted its current best-of-seven format. The 2001 Los Angeles Lakers went 15–1 under the earlier format, also establishing one of the league’s most efficient title runs.
These records support strong claims about playoff dominance, but they do not settle every comparison. Golden State’s unusually talented roster may lead some observers to view its path as less uncertain. The Lakers’ opponents and the league’s competitive balance were also different.
Conversely, needing seven games does not automatically expose a weak champion. A long series may reflect elite opposition, an unfavourable matchup or a successful response to adversity.
Series length is best interpreted alongside opponent quality rather than used alone.
4. Examine Scoring Margin and Game Control
Win-loss records treat a one-point victory and a 30-point victory equally. Scoring margin provides additional information about how much control a champion demonstrated.
Analysts can calculate average playoff point differential:
Average point differential = total scoring margin ÷ playoff games
A large positive result suggests that the team consistently outscored opponents. Yet averages can also be distorted by one or two blowouts. Median margin and the number of close games may provide further context.
Game control is another useful concept. A champion may win by ten points after trailing for most of the night, while another may lead comfortably from the first quarter onward. Both receive the same result, but their routes to victory differ.
Detailed possession data can help measure this distinction in modern seasons. For older title runs, analysts often have to rely on box scores, reports and available footage, making cross-era precision more difficult.
5. Account for Home-Court Advantage
Home-court advantage influences travel, preparation and the setting of a deciding game. Historically, home teams have performed particularly well in Game 7 of the NBA Finals.
Through the 2026 postseason, home teams had won 16 of the first 20 Finals Game 7s. That does not guarantee victory, but it suggests that location may become especially important when a championship is decided in one game.
The Finals schedule itself has also changed. For many years, the league used a 2-3-2 format, giving the lower-seeded team three consecutive home games in the middle of the series. The NBA returned to a 2-2-1-1-1 structure in 2014. Historical results suggest that teams holding home-court advantage were successful under both arrangements, although the travel and adjustment patterns differed.
When evaluating a title run, analysts should note whether the champion repeatedly won on the road or benefited from hosting decisive games.
6. Separate Memorable Moments From Overall Performance
Finals history is often remembered through individual scenes: a late shot, a critical block, an injured player returning or a decisive Game 7 performance.
Examples include Willis Reed’s appearance in Game 7 of the 1970 Finals, Magic Johnson starting at centre in 1980, Michael Jordan’s final shot against Utah in 1998 and Ray Allen’s game-tying three-pointer in 2013. The NBA’s historical archive treats these as defining Finals moments because they changed games and shaped how championship runs are remembered.
However, one unforgettable play should not replace analysis of the entire series. A famous shot may decide the result, but earlier defensive possessions, lineup changes and scoring runs made that shot meaningful.
Narrative and data answer different questions. Data estimates overall quality; narrative explains why a title remains culturally memorable.
7. Consider Injuries Without Rewriting the Result
Injury context is necessary but difficult to apply consistently.
A champion may face an opponent missing a star, while also managing injuries within its own rotation. Some injuries are obvious and documented. Others involve players competing at reduced effectiveness without missing games.
The safest conclusion is usually conditional. Analysts can say that an opponent’s absence probably reduced the difficulty of a series, but they cannot know with certainty what would have happened with full health.
Every postseason contains availability advantages and disadvantages. A title should remain official and fully recognised, while the surrounding conditions can still inform comparisons.
In other words, context should refine the evaluation—not be used to erase the championship.
8. Reward Adaptability and Elimination-Game Performance
Championship teams must solve several different problems. One opponent may play slowly through a dominant centre. Another may rely on switching, shooting or transition speed.
Adaptability can be assessed through lineup changes, defensive coverages, rotation decisions and performance after losses. A team that repeatedly responds well after opponents expose weaknesses may have demonstrated more resilience than its final record reveals.
Elimination games provide another useful measure. Bill Russell, for example, won all ten Game 7s in which he played. That record supports his reputation as an exceptional performer in high-pressure team situations, although his teammates and the competitive environment must also be considered.
Still, analysts should avoid overvaluing “clutch” samples. A handful of elimination games can contain considerable randomness. Larger samples are more reliable, but postseason careers rarely provide enormous ones.
9. Verify the Data Before Ranking Runs
Historical playoff statistics can differ because sources use different definitions, include different league periods or update corrections at different times.
Before sharing a ranking, confirm the season, series format and whether a figure refers to NBA-only or combined NBA and ABA records. A balanced title-run model might include opponent strength, playoff winning percentage, point differential, road success and elimination-game performance. No weighting system will be completely objective, but publishing the criteria allows readers to understand the conclusion.
The strongest claim may not be that one championship run was unquestionably the greatest. A more defensible conclusion is that different runs led in different categories. The 2017 Warriors have a compelling efficiency case. The 2001 Lakers produced comparable short-term dominance under another format. Other champions may stand out for opponent quality, resilience or memorable Finals execution.
Championships provide the final answer to a season. Careful analysis explains how difficult, dominant and historically significant that answer may have been.
